Sweden: Club Destroyed by Fire after Possible Detonation

On 26 June 2019 at approximately 0300 hours local time, police responded to reports of a fire that authorities believe was caused by an explosive device at a club in Örebro in central Sweden. The ensuing fire destroyed the entire building, but no one was injured. Police suspect that the explosion was a deliberate act directed at people with criminal links. No further information was provided on the cause of the explosion, and an investigation is ongoing.

Missouri: Suspected IED Discovered in Vehicle

On 24 June 2019 at approximately 1700 hours local time, a Goose Creek officer reported the discovery of a suspected pipe bomb in a vehicle during a traffic stop. A St. Francois County Sheriff’s Department K-9 unit picked up the scent of an explosive device, and deputies requested the assistance of the Missouri State Highway Patrol Bomb Squad. At the time of reporting, the investigation is ongoing.

South Korea: Suspected VBIED Attack on U.S. Embassy

On 25 June 2019 at approximately 1800 hours local time, a rental vehicle with 30 butane gas canisters in the trunk rammed into the gates of the U.S. Embassy in Seoul. No one was injured by the vehicle-borne IED (VBIED), and the gates were only slightly damaged. Local police arrested a 40-year-old suspect at the scene. Police have not stated a possible motive, although President Trump is scheduled to visit the country on Saturday.

United Kingdom: Explosive Device Found in Alley

On 24 June 2019 at approximately 0730 hours local time, police responded to reports of a suspicious object in an alley on the outskirts of Belfast in Dunmurry. An army bomb squad determined the object was a viable explosive device. This incident follows a series of bomb scares in Northern Ireland over the weekend.

Saudi Arabia: 1 Killed, 21 Injured in UAS Attack on Airport

On 23 June 2019, 1 person died and 21 others were injured after an unmanned aircraft system (UAS) hit the parking lot of the Abha International Airport. Eighteen vehicles and a restaurant were also damaged in the explosion. Iranian-backed Houthi rebels in Yemen claimed responsibility for the attack on the airport, which is located 200 km from the border with Yemen.
